Quick Facts

Marinette shines with Friday fish fries and perch dinners, a cherished Wisconsin tradition drawing crowds for fresh, social seafood meals.
Family-run icons like Mickey-Lu Bar-B-Q (since 1942) serve up legendary charcoal-grilled burgers and hot dogs in a classic small-town setting.
The Brothers Three (since 1972) is famous for thin-crust pizzas, alongside Mexican and Italian dishes that add diverse comfort to the lineup.
Riverside spots like Rail House Restaurant & Brewpub offer house-made beers paired with hearty American fare in historic, relaxed vibes.
Casual dining dominates with influences from Native American, French, and European roots, creating a welcoming mix of homestyle eats.
No major food awards noted, but community favorites highlight the area's strength in everyday, heritage-driven culinary experiences.

Marinette's Culinary Identity

What sets Marinette's food scene apart is its unpretentious, community-hearted approach—think riverside perch dinners and Friday fish fries that capture the essence of Wisconsin's freshwater bounty and small-town warmth. Rooted in influences from Native American, French, and European settlers, the cuisine focuses on hearty, accessible American comfort foods with casual nods to Mexican and Italian flavors, all served in family-friendly spots that feel like extensions of home. It's a scene that prioritizes connection over trends, making every meal a relaxed escape from the daily grind.

Friday fish fries and perch dinners as social staples, featuring fresh local seafood in breaded, golden perfection.
Traditional American comfort foods like prime rib, mac 'n' cheese, steaks, and burgers grilled over charcoal.
Mexican specialties including fresh burritos and tacos at spots like Blue Bike Burrito (since 2007).
Italian-inspired thin-crust pizzas and pasta dishes from long-time favorites.
Brewpub experiences with house-made beers complementing hearty, riverside meals.

Notable Restaurants & Dining Culture

Marinette's dining culture thrives on longstanding, family-operated gems that have fed generations, emphasizing big portions, welcoming atmospheres, and events tied to local heritage like the annual Logging and Heritage Festival. While formal awards are scarce, customer raves spotlight the unbeatable quality of casual eats— from impeccable fish fries to the 'best chicken ever'—in a scene geared toward Packers game gatherings and everyday family outings. Trends lean toward diverse yet approachable options, with nearby Menominee spots adding upscale seafood for variety, all fostering that feel-good sense of belonging.

Mickey-Lu Bar-B-Q (since 1942): Iconic for charcoal-grilled burgers and hot dogs in a historic, no-frills setup.
The Brothers Three (since 1972): Beloved pizzeria offering thin-crust pies, sandwiches, and Mexican-Italian hybrids.
Rivers Edge: Riverside haven for top-rated Friday fish fries and American classics with scenic views.
Rail House Restaurant & Brewpub: Historic spot with house-brewed beers and hearty meals for casual brews and bites.
Blue Bike Burrito (since 2007): Fresh Mexican tacos and burritos, adding vibrant flavor to the casual lineup.
